How to Install the Drivers Without GeForce Experience. Download the driver's EXE file and double-click it to install like any other application. Let the installer extract its files and begin installation. After the installer extracts its files and starts, you'll be prompted to choose the kind of installation you want. No. NVIDIA DCH Display Drivers cannot be over-installed on top of NVIDIA Standard Display Drivers.
